Maṇipūraka chakra it’s the place of Agni or fire and the Bīja mantra for the element fire is RAM. Maṇi means: what is precious or precious gem a jewel a Pearl and pūraka means: a flood a stream of a fulgence / λαμπρο πετραδι. So Maṇipūraka can be translated: as the resplendent gem. It’s at the naval the belly button but technically generally described as just below the knobby just below the navel and of course behind because it’s deep on the inside.
Maṇipūraka chakra its element is fire and its shape is a red colored downward pointing triangle and its Lotus is a ten paddled dark blue Lotus flower (with each pedal for 10 of the sounds). The 10 of the sounds of the alphabet, each is associated with ten petals of the dark blue Lotus that is installed at Maṇipūraka chakra and it is the color of heavily laden rain clouds. That’s the color of this Lotus: dark blue like heavily laden rain clouds. The Lord is RUDRA. RUDRA is now often associated with Śiva. Rudra in Vedas is the God of storm and is also associated with the goddess Lākinī and Agni Devā: the God of fire. It’s Bīja mantra RAM, it’s senses is sight because that is the sense of fire and its Vāyu is Samāna Vāyu, that’s the Vāyu responsible for digestion but it’s also a place where Prāṇā and Apāna converge.
